✅ The Dos: Actions to Take Following Windshield Replacement
1.Wait Before Driving
After a windshield replacement, the adhesive used needs time to cure and bond properly.
✔ Do: Wait at least one hour before driving your car.
✔ Why it matters: By allowing the urethane sealant to solidify, a secure and robust bond is ensured.
2. Keep a Window Slightly Open
✔ Do: Leave one window (preferably a side window) slightly open for the first 24 hours.
✔ Why it matters: It prevents pressure buildup inside the car that can cause the seal to weaken or develop leaks.
3. Avoid Car Washes
✔ Do: Wait at least 48–72 hours before washing your car or using a high-pressure hose.
✔ Why it matters: Water or cleaning agents can interfere with the curing process and damage the new seal.
4. Drive Carefully
✔ Do: Take it easy for the first couple of days after the replacement.
✔ Why it matters: Slamming doors, hitting bumps, or aggressive driving may shift the glass or break the fresh seal.
5. Inspect for Leaks or Wind Noise
✔ Do: Pay attention to unusual sounds or water ingress.
✔ Why it matters: These could indicate a faulty installation, and catching them early helps avoid major repairs.

❌ The Don’ts: Errors to Steer Clear of Following Windshield Replacement
1.Don’t Remove the Retention Tape
❌ Don’t: Remove the tape applied around the edges of the windshield.
❌ Why not? That tape helps hold the glass in place while the adhesive cures. Removing it too early can compromise the seal.
2. Don’t Slam the Doors
❌ Don’t: Slam doors for the first 1–2 days.
❌ Why not? Forceful closing creates pressure that can loosen the windshield before the adhesive is fully set.
3. Don’t Use Sunshades or Covers
❌ Don’t: Use dashboard sun protectors or car covers during the first 24–48 hours.
❌ Why not? These can interfere with the adhesive curing due to trapped heat or added pressure.
4. Don’t Ignore Warning Signs
❌ Don’t: Ignore wind noise, rattling, or leaks.
❌ Why not? These may be signs of improper installation or a weak bond, and they should be addressed immediately.

1.How long does it take for a new windshield to cure fully?
The adhesive usually takes 24 to 48 hours to completely cure. During this time, avoid car washes and rough driving.
2. After having a windshield replaced, is it safe to drive?
You should wait at least one hour before driving. Your technician will inform you of the safe drive-away time.
3. Can I wash my car after getting a windshield replaced?
Avoid washing your car for 48–72 hours after replacement to protect the seal and curing adhesive.
4. What should I do if I hear wind noise after replacement?
Wind noise may indicate an improper seal. Contact your service provider (like Auto Glass Tec) to inspect the installation.
